All construction shall con forni to the latest edition of the Florida Building Code if not specified below. 2. All framing shall be exterior grade pressure treated lumber. 3. All fasteners, nails, bolts etc that shall come into contact with exterior grade pressure treated lumber (or any lumber treated with a Copp r based solution), where the final component is to be exposed to the weather, shall be `Z-MAX', hot -dipped galvanized (HDG) or stainless steel. Use only hot -dipped galvanized fasteners with 'Z-MAX' or hot -dipped galvanized connectors. Use only 1,3tainless steel fasteners with stainless steel connectors. 4. The deck is designed as a firter e-standing structure and shall not )e connected to the existing structure. 5. Contractor to frame perime of deck and mount to posts fir enough away from structure to allow for installation of all connectors. 6. Move deck frame and post into finish position and mark locations of post anchors. Install post anchors. Install and fasten frame dec and posts to the post anchors. 7. Install P.T. decking, stairs ar d railing. 8. All frame to frame connecti ns not specified in the details sha!I be Simpson .220 Strong -Drive screws with minimum 2" embedment. 9. All fastening procedures Ahall be in accordance with the manufacturer's recommendations and all components attached to the ptructure shall be designed and installed to resist the design wind force.
